ABSTRACT
Girls 14 to 16 years of age, menstruating regularly and with a stabile cycle, were tested every school-day by a dictation in their slovakian language. Mistakes were counted and analysed statistically. The girls were interviewed about their cycle. Their capacity to write down the text correctly was different in the four phases of the cycle (P less than 0,001). Most mistakes were made in the premenstrual phase, results were found in the four days of the menstruum. Divided in terziles according to their capacity, the girls of the best terzile had their optimum in the postmenstrual phase, whereas the girls in the medium and in the lower tezile had their optimum during the menstruation.
